Trim the tip of the broccoli. Cut head into small florets and stem into 2cm pieces. Trim and thinly slice the scallions. Peel and grate the garlic (or use a garlic press). Halve, peel and chop the onion into small pieces.
Place a pan over high heat (no oil).
Once the pan is hot, fry the mince,ras el hanout, garlic, broccoli,onion and coleslaw mix for 5-6 mins. Use a spoon to break it up as it cooks. Season with salt and pepper. Stir in the harissa paste and cook for 1-2 mins.
IMPORTANT: Wash hands and equipment after handling raw mince. Mince is cooked when no longer pink in the middle.
Place a pot/pan over medium-high heat. Once hot, add the rice, tahini, miso, and a good splash of water. Cover and allow to warm through completely, 3-5 mins. Season to taste with salt and pepper.
TIP: To microwave, open the top of the packet and cook in the microwave until warmed through, 2-3 mins.
Divide the rice between two bowls and top with the stir-fry. Scatter the sesame seeds over the top.
